The core engineering behind a dependable Ceiling Fan Installation focuses on securing the surprise structure within the roofing system cavity to absorb consistent rotational physics and ongoing functional stress. Due to the fact that a fan functions as a moving mechanical device, it produces special vibrant forces, centrifugal loads, and torque pressures that standard lighting components never ever put on a structure. Technical installation procedures dictate that the installing assembly needs to completely bypass weak plasterboard panels, anchoring rather into heavy lumber trusses or custom-installed strengthening noggins. Structure this strong architectural foundation gets rid of the annoying wobbles, balanced clicks, and motor hums that can slowly jeopardize surrounding materials in time. Additionally, professional installation teams utilize specialized weight-distribution gauges to line up the pitch of each blade exactly, eliminating micro-vibrations and ensuring that the internal motor parts run smoothly and quietly for years to come.

Strategic spatial mapping is another important requirement of a successful Ceiling Fan Installation, as maintaining specific vertical and horizontal security boundaries is necessary for both efficiency and compliance. Stringent building requirements dictate that the spinning blades need to be placed a minimum of 2 point one metres above the completed floor level to protect high residents from any possibility of unexpected physical contact. In homes featuring compact layouts or lower ceiling heights, specialized low-profile hugger fans are flawlessly incorporated to provide outstanding air distribution without encroaching on the vertical headspace. Alternatively, extensive open-plan living areas or architectural residential or commercial properties with soaring cathedral ceilings need the precise addition of get more info extension downrods to prevent a phenomenon called cavitation. This calculated vertical extension positions the blades at the perfect height to actively draw down fresh air currents and distribute them evenly throughout the lower living zones.

The scope of a normal ceiling‑fan installation has broadened dramatically thanks to quick advances in brushless DC motor styles and built‑in home‑automation networks. Today's house owners are moving from outdated AC fans to these high‑tech options, which run nearly silently and consume only a small portion of the power. These contemporary fans conceal compact digital receivers inside the ceiling canopy, allowing them to link effortlessly with wireless wall switches, handheld remotes, or centralized smart‑home platforms. When a completely certified electrician manages the job, the delicate digital parts are properly separated and designated to dedicated circuits, safeguarding them from abrupt grid spikes. This mindful circuitry guarantees the new system runs efficiently, prevents nuisance trips of residual‑current devices, and does not interfere with existing wireless signals.
